History & Context

History Avon Lake is a city located in Lorain County, Ohio, United States. It is situated on the shores of Lake Erie, about 20 miles west of Cleveland. The history of Avon Lake is closely tied to the growth and development of the Great Lakes region. Here's an overview of its history: Early Settlement: The area where Avon Lake is now located was originally inhabited by Native American tribes, including the Erie and Ottawa. European settlement began in the early 19th century as pioneers and settlers moved westward. The construction of the Ohio and Erie Canal in the 1820s facilitated transportation and trade, leading to increased settlement in the region. Rise of Industry: As the 19th century progressed, the industrial revolution brought significant changes to the area. The establishment of industries such as shipbuilding, salt mining, and fishing played a crucial role in shaping the local economy. The presence of Lake Erie facilitated transportation and provided resources for these industries.
